  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the Statutory Power of Attorney for Health Care - Wisconsin in our editor.
  2. Begin by filling in your personal information, including your name, address, and date of birth. This establishes your identity as the principal.
  3. Designate your health care agent by entering their name, address, and phone number. If you have an alternate agent, provide their details as well.
  4. Review the general statement of authority granted to ensure it aligns with your wishes regarding health care decisions.
  5. Specify any limitations on mental health treatment and whether you allow admission to nursing homes or community-based facilities.
  6. Complete the anatomical gifts section if applicable, indicating your wishes regarding organ donation.
  7. Sign and date the document at the designated area. Ensure that two witnesses also sign to validate the document.

The agents power is typically activated upon a determination by two physicians or one physician and one psychologist who have personally examined you and have determined that you are incapacitated. The certification of incapacity must be attached to the POA-HC document.
ower of attorney for health care is a legal document that makes it possible for you to authorize another individuala health care agentto make health care decisions on your behalf if you are not capable of doing so. The statutory power of attorney for health care form became effective in Wisconsin April 28, 1990.
Unless otherwise specified in the Power of Attorney for Health Care instrument (form), an individuals Power of Attorney for Health Care takes effect upon a finding of incapacity by 2 physicians, as defined in State Statute 448.01 (5), or one physician and one advanced practice clinician, as defined in State Statute.
